### AI Content Personalization – A Game Changer for User Experience
As organizations seek to enhance user engagement and customer satisfaction, AI content personalization has become a pivotal focus in the development of AI technologies. Personalization leverages machine learning algorithms to tailor content based on user preferences, behavior, and demographic information.
With the integration of the AIOS framework, the process of deploying content personalization algorithms has become significantly more streamlined. Developers can utilize AIOS’s pre-built modules specifically designed for this purpose, thus minimizing the coding burden. The framework enables companies to create bespoke content experiences that can substantially improve user interaction.
An example of how AI content personalization can drive engagement is seen in the media and entertainment industry. Streaming services like Netflix and Spotify use AI personalization algorithms to recommend shows and songs based on users’ viewing and listening histories. A study published in the Journal of Artificial Intelligence Research found that personalized content recommendations can enhance user retention rates by up to 30%.
Moreover, businesses in e-commerce can significantly benefit from AI content personalization. By analyzing consumer behavior through extensive datasets, companies can present tailored product recommendations that resonate with individual users, ultimately increasing conversion rates. A recent report from McKinsey indicates that personalized marketing can lift sales by 10% to 30%, showcasing the financial advantages of employing AI for content personalization.
